Beating Budget aim, Centre gave states INR 1.46 tln as capex loans as of Wed

--Sitharaman: Released INR 1.46 tln as capex loans to states as of Mar 26 

--Sitharaman: Approved INR 1.54 tln as capex loans to states for FY25 

 

NEW DELHI – Beating revised Budget projections, the Centre released INR 1.46 trillion to states as 50-year interest-free loans under the Scheme for Special Assistance to States for Capital Expenditure as of Wednesday, Finance Minister Nirmala Sitharaman said Tuesday. The Centre has also approved loans to the tune of INR 1.54 trillion for states' under this scheme, higher than the original Budget estimate of INR 1.50 trillion for the financial year ended Monday, she told the Rajya Sabha.

 

The Budget for 2024-25 (Apr-Mar) had earlier projected the outlay for these 50-year interest-free loans to states at INR 1.50 trillion, however, in the Budget for FY26, the outlay was revised down to INR 1.25 trillion. 

 

Informist had reported on Jan. 23 that the government was making an effort to accelerate disbursement under the scheme and even tweaked the conditions for the release of funds to facilitate the same. A senior finance ministry official had told Informist that the Centre was fairly confident that the entire amount will be released to states by the end of FY25. 

 

Launched in the Budget for FY22, the Scheme for Special Assistance to States for Capital Investment is in line with the government's thrust on capital expenditure to drive economic growth.  End
